I have a photo in my gallery with my DRL jumper.. The wire that feeds the Hi beam indicator is the Red/Grey 20 ga wire. If you test that wire with a test light/volt meter you should see some voltage there. I think with your newer dash, the indicator may be LED instead of a regular bulb. However, the Voltmeter should show something at that wire output.
The wires may be in slightly different positions, but the colour should be the same..

It looks like the input for the high beam on the drl module is pin 1 a red/orange wire and the output for the high beam indicator lamp is pin 4 a red/grey wire. Aso apparently there is a high beam indicator lamp driver in the instrument cluster.

Ok heres the testing I have done.
Light is good
Tried new display assembly speedo,tach etc unit from another truck
tried different DRL module from a working truck
Still.... High beams work fine, DRL lights work fine NO high beam indicator
When testing a working truck I found the high beam indicator wire red-grey had 12.5 volts when the lights where OFF and .5 volts when on. on MY truck I had 12.5 volts either way is there something that makes the ground to get the light to come on as the only thing it can be is a ground issue or am I missing something.

I think thats the problem we are hitting here is that after 99, the trucks went to a positive to ground lighting system. That being that (like import cars) the circuits are live with 12V and are grounded by the switch to make the circuit.
My guess is that the indicator lite may be grounded through the multi-function switch in the column. That may just need a blast of electronics cleaner to get it to work again. Or the head light switch may be a culprit as well. With the wiring diagrams from Jeff, one could figure it out pretty quickly..
